UTV accident on Big Canyon Rd in Murray Co. kills 1
Posted on Friday, April 11th, 2025 at 1:47 am
MURRAY CO., OK – A 41-year-old man died Tuesday in a crash involving a utility task vehicle in east-central Murray County, reports KXII 12.
The incident occurred at night along Big Canyon Road, just south of Sulphur. This is about 85 miles southeast of Oklahoma City.
Police say that Randy Gaither of Sulphur lost control of his UTV while navigating a curve and crashed into a tree alongside Big Canyon Road.
Authorities pronounced Gaither deceased at the scene of the wreck.
There were no other passengers in the UTV at the time of the crash.
A full investigation is underway.
